Holy Apostles College and Seminary Graduate Programs Overview

Holy Apostles College and Seminary is a Private, 4-years school located in Cromwell, CT. Holy Apostles College and Seminary offers total 11 graduate programs through Master's, Post-graduate certificate degree/programs.
The 2023 graduate tuition & fees at Holy Apostles College and Seminary is $7,480 when a student attends full-time status. The tuition per credit hour is $390 for part-time students or overloaded credits. Total 448 students have enrolled in graduate programs where the school has total population of 719 with undergraduate students.

Who Accredits Holy Apostles College and Seminary

Holy Apostles College and Seminary is accredited by New England Commission of Higher Education (10/23/1979 - Current).

2023 Graduate Tuition & Fees

For academic year 2022-2023, the average tuition & fees of Holy Apostles College and Seminary graduate programs is $7,480. The tuition per credit hour for graduate program is $390. The average living costs is $15,410 when a student lives on campus housing.

Graduate Student Population

At Holy Apostles College and Seminary graduate schools, there are total 448 graduate students. Among them, 395 students have enrolled graduate programs online exclusively. By gender, there are 318 men and 130 women students at Holy Apostles College and Seminary graduate schools.
